the area of the triangle above is 21. what is the value of ( x )?
( \bigcirc 3 )
( \bigcirc 6 )
( \bigcirc 7 )
( \bigcirc 11 )
Step1: Recall triangle area formula
The area of a triangle is $\frac{1}{2} \times \text{base} \times \text{height}$. Here, base = $x+1$, height = $x$, area = 21.
Step2: Substitute values into formula
$\frac{1}{2} \times (x+1) \times x = 21$
Step3: Simplify the equation
Multiply both sides by 2: $x(x+1) = 42$
Expand: $x^2 + x - 42 = 0$
Step4: Factor the quadratic equation
$(x+7)(x-6) = 0$
Step5: Solve for x
Solutions are $x=-7$ or $x=6$. Since length cannot be negative, $x=6$.
